"Where did my life go wrong?"

Divorced, in need to pay child-support, and now a layoff candidate at his company; Orimo Keita, 34 years old was in the pits of despair. However, it all changes when his brain suddenly became a smartphone! Now his vision can see messages people send on their phones, which also means that he can learn their secrets. This new ability gets him intertwined with problems in and out of the office! A Sci-fi human drama about a simple man becoming a "Smartphone" hero.
